The People Score for the Prostate Cancer Score in 35592, Vernon, Alabama is 51 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
An estimate of 89.70 percent of the residents in 35592 has some form of health insurance. 52.99 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 44.37 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 35592 would have to travel an average of 16.23 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Fayette Medical Center. In a 20-mile radius, there are 148 healthcare providers accessible to residents living in 35592, Vernon, Alabama.

Before we stroll down Main Street, let’s get our bearings. The "Prostate Cancer Score" isn't a single, definitive metric. Instead, it's a composite assessment, a mosaic built from various factors that influence prostate cancer risk and outcomes. These include:
* **Demographics:** Age distribution, race, and socioeconomic status play a significant role.
* **Access to Healthcare:** Availability of primary care physicians, urologists, and screening facilities.
* **Lifestyle Factors:** Diet, exercise, smoking habits, and alcohol consumption.
* **Environmental Factors:** Exposure to pollutants and access to green spaces.
* **Community Resources:** Support groups, wellness programs, and health education initiatives.
